Action item PM-7 (Garnet outage): refactor the legacy Wexley ORM layer. Lazy-loading caused the N+1 storm that took down checkout. New team members: do not add models to Wexley; use the Caldera data layer instead. Migration is tracked per-table with owners assigned. Scope, timeline, and table status are on the page below.

operations page: https://confluence.qorvellabs.internal/pages/projects/projects/projects

# Break-Glass: Hooklane Webhook Delivery

Scope: release managers only.

Use break-glass when Hooklane's retry queue is wedged — exponential backoff stuck, dead-letter bin overflowing, deliveries past the 24h retry ceiling. Break-glass pauses retries, drains the queue, and replays in order. Do not use for single failed endpoints. Access requires the emergency account plus the recovery passphrase noted below.

unlock words, hahip-baduf: holwyn-istath-julvan

## Health Checks

The Marrowgate load balancer probes `/healthz` on each Ledgewick API node every 10 seconds. A node is drained after three consecutive failures and restored after two passes. The endpoint returns 200 only when the database pool, cache, and outbound queue are all reachable; partial failures return 503 with a JSON body listing the failing subsystem. Deep checks via `/healthz?deep=true` are rate-limited and require authentication against the internal probe service. Probes authenticate with the key below.

service key, fawip-bajef: kto11_Qt5wZK9vdNC

## Changelog — Lockerly access flow, v3.2

Changed defaults for the laundry-locker access flow. PIN entry is no longer the primary unlock method; app-based tap is default, PIN is fallback. Idle lockers now auto-release after 48 hours instead of 72. Maintenance override codes rotate weekly rather than monthly. Failed-unlock lockout drops from 10 attempts to 5. If you're onboarding, note that older site docs still describe v2 behavior — ignore them. New installs at the Bramford sites ship with the following default configuration.

settings of yageg-yahap:
[gorael]
team = olieth
access_code = ac_941d74
owner = brieth.aldiel
host = gorael.tolvaqio.internal
port = 6379
peer = briwyn.urlaqtech.internal
salt = 116e6622
pin = 1957